Payment statistics
Average time taken to pay invoices: 37 days
Invoices paid:
- within 30 days: 31%
- in 31 to 60 days: 58%
- in 61 days or more: 11%
Invoices due but not paid within agreed terms: 69%

Dispute resolution process
The company attempts in good faith to settle within 20 working days of either party notifying the other of the dispute. If necessary, such efforts will involve the escalation of the dispute to the company's Procurement and Contracts Manager and the supplier's Contract Manager who will endeavour to resolve the dispute by negotiation.
